    Requirements for Brazilian Passport Renewal:

    To renew your Brazilian passport, you must meet the following requirements:

    1. You must be a Brazilian citizen.
    2. Your previous passport must be in good condition. If it’s damaged, you will need to apply for a new passport instead of renewing the old one.
    3. Your previous passport must not have been issued more than 10 years ago. If it’s older than 10 years, you will need to apply for a new passport.
    4. You must provide a recent passport-sized photo. The photo must meet specific requirements, including size, background color, and facial expression.
    5. You must pay the renewal fee.

    Steps for Brazilian Passport Renewal:

    The process of renewing your Brazilian passport can be completed online or in person at a Brazilian consulate or embassy. Here are the steps to renew your Brazilian passport:

    1. Gather the necessary documents: Before you start the renewal process, make sure you have all the required documents, including your previous passport, a recent passport-sized photo, and any other supporting documents if necessary.

    2. Complete the online application form: If you choose to renew your passport online, visit the official website of the Brazilian consulate or embassy. Fill out the online application form with accurate information and upload the required documents.

    3. Pay the renewal fee: Once you have completed the application form, you will need to pay the renewal fee. The fee can be paid online using a credit or debit card.

    4. Schedule an appointment: If you are renewing your passport in person, you will need to schedule an appointment at the Brazilian consulate or embassy. Choose a convenient date and time for your appointment.

    5. Submit your application: On the day of your appointment, bring all the required documents and submit your application to the consular officer. Your application will be processed, and you will receive a new passport within a few weeks.
